DP World is looking for an adept professional as Director, Business Development with experience of complex sales cycle and proven track record to generate, qualify and manage leads in the United States . You must have in-depth contract logistics knowledge across multiple sectors, with the ability to define scope of projects based on data gathered from multiple touch points. At DP World we work in cross-functional teams so you will need to demonstrate a clear understanding in operations, finance, along with the practical & technical knowledge in logistics to support ideas.

As the Director, Business Development, you will engage with prospective clients to supercharge the effectiveness of our value added services. You will foster relationships with large scale companies through deep engagement and interventions to close business partnerships. This role will provide business operations with critical insights using analytics, and drive strategic partnerships and new initiatives.

QUALIFICATIONS, SKILLS & EXPERIENCE
  • Bachelor's degree or equivalent in Business, Engineering, and/or Supply Chain preferred; Masters degree a plus
  • Must have at least 10years of applicable Vertical Market/ industry experience in supply chain/logistics and have a track record of 5 years in winning new clients within respective global industry market
  • Exposure to and working knowledge of all facets of applicable Industry Vertical quality standards such as TS-16949 and industry quality system tools i.e. AQP, FMEAs, Control Plans, Poke Yoke/Mistake Proofing, PPAP, Run at Rate, Root Cause Analysis/8D-5D Corrective Action, PPM targets, SPC, Continuous Improvement Action Plans
  • Exposure to and working knowledge of all facets of applicable Vertical Market advanced manufacturing and supply chain models such as Lean manufacturing, Flexible manufacturing lines, In Line Vehicle Sequencing (ILVS), CKD, Returnable Packaging, JIT/VMI, Containment Action Plans
  • Exposure to and working knowledge of all facets of applicable Vertical Market contractual requirements of supply base such as year over year cost down commitments, non-performance/downtime charge backs, liability/risks i.e. handling inverted delta/safety related parts (brake systems, air bags), electronic invoice and payment, YOY cost down commitments, performance/downtime charge backs, Pain/Gain share models, etc.
  • Experience in developing opportunities across the supply chain (Air, Ocean, Land/Truck and Contract Logistics services)
